I loved Lucy so my review may be skewed, but only slightly :>). There are two areas - the Lucy and Desi. I started in the Lucy area which has a lot of reasonably priced memorabilia. I was surprised that they didn't have things to buy for one's grandchildren. I did get a few things for my wife. You can negotiate the price if you want the tour guide to take your pictures using your own camera. I did that, and the guide took pictures of my group and I in the different Lucy sets (recreated). The guide, who was dressed in a Lucy dress, was very knowledgeable. Looking at the sets brought back a lot of memories. Next was the Desi area in an adjacent building. There too are things to buy, I learned that Desilu Studios also produced Star Tek, Mission Impossible, etc.
One can easily spend a couple of hours at the Lucy Desi Museum.
